自己怎么做鲜花网站,物流信息网站,如何建立优秀企业网站,wordpress 移动端模板下载写在前面
当使用命令 docker pull mysql 拉取镜像时#xff0c;其实等价于如下命令
docker pull mysql:latest
latest 是默认的标签#xff0c;字面上理解为最新版本的镜像#xff0c;实质上 latest 只是镜像的标签名称#xff0c;跟具体某个版本号地位一样#xff0c;…写在前面
当使用命令 docker pull mysql 拉取镜像时其实等价于如下命令
docker pull mysql:latest
latest 是默认的标签字面上理解为最新版本的镜像实质上 latest 只是镜像的标签名称跟具体某个版本号地位一样有 latest 标签的镜像不一定是最新版本镜像作者可以任意指定标签。 一般来说我们会使用 latest 作为最新镜像的标识这是约定。但一旦该镜像被拉取到本地版本号就已经确定不会自动更新。
查看latest镜像的具体版本
docker image inspect mysql:latest | grep -i version
更新 latest 标签的镜像
docker pull mysql:latest
如果 DockerHub 上 latest 标签的镜像有更新则上述命令会下载最新版本的镜像且把本地老的latest 镜像的标签移除。
更新本地所有latest标签的镜像
docker images --format {{.Repository}}:{{.Tag}} | grep :latest | xargs -L1 docker pull
一键删除标签镜像
docker images | grep none | awk { print $3; } | xargs docker rmi